3 How can I stop being so shy? I want to make friends, be popular and talk to people easily, but I’m not sure how.
a Most people are shy from time to time, so you’re not alone. If you meet new people, ask them about their interests and their everyday life. It’s a great way to break the ice and turn strangers into friends. Start making friendly conversations today. You won’t develop your social skills unless you try.

Language Points
1. I find it hard to control my bad moods. 我感觉很难控制自己的坏情绪。
find it +形容词+ to do sth 发觉做……是…… e.g. I find it difficult to get along with him. 我感觉和他相处挺难的。
